KBJ25A THRU KBJ25M
Glass Passivated Construction High Case Dielectric Strength 1500VRMS Reverse Leakage Current Surge Overload Rating 350A Peak Ideal Printed Circuit Board Applications Plastic Material Flammability Classification 94V-0
CURRENT 25.0 Amperes VOLTAGE 1000 Volts
